Some cities pour millions into cycle lanes but ignore the final meter. Finnish company Biketty Oy has found a large-scale bicycle parking solution.

The company’s primary purpose was to operate parking facilities and build car parks in the Finnish town of Seinäjoki. However, the city also considered it important to develop bicycle parking as part of its mobility solutions. When a new railway station and station district were built in the city, a bicycle parking facility was planned alongside the car park.

Also, Aalto University is committed to sustainable development and to promoting environmentally friendly, healthy modes of transport on campus. As part of this effort, two innovative Biketti bicycle-parking containers have now been installed on campus.

Cars are large, easily monitored vehicles that can be readily identified by their authority-issued registration numbers via camera-based license plate recognition. With cars, it is the vehicle itself that is monitored, rather than its user. “A bicycle has no such identifier, which makes it technically more challenging to sell short-term parking — for example, in intervals of minutes or a few hours. In large bicycle parking facilities, the only product on offer is often a monthly contract,” says Mika Mäntykoski, CEO at Seipark Oy, a parking services company owned by the City of Seinäjoki.

Biketti bike containers offer a simple, safe, and convenient solution to cyclists’ parking challenges. They directly address the frequent feedback on better cycling infrastructure highlighted in Aalto University’s annual campus survey. With their innovative design, the Biketti units demonstrate the University’s strong commitment to sustainable transportation and to making everyday cycling a more attractive option for commuters.

The Biketti units come in various sizes, holding between 10 and several hundred bikes. They keep cycles secure and offer self-service access for repairs and cleaning.

However, there is still room for improvement. Seipark’s goal is to develop a post-payment system for bicycle parking — similar to how car parking works — in which the fee is charged after the fact based on time used. According to Mika Mäntykoski, achieving this would appear to require additional investment and joint planning with Biketti Oy. “Instead of monitoring the cyclist, we would need to be able to monitor the movement of the bicycle in and out of the facility, just as we do with cars.”
“We use ethically sourced timber and have architects to ensure that our bike garages not only function well but also look good,” says Janne Kalliomäki, CEO of Biketti.
